Free cakeballs at Bread Winners Cafe

Bread Winners Cafe, which has a location in the Inwood Village, is giving away free cakeballs through Friday to celebrate 16 years in business. They’re calling it their Sweet 16 Cakeball, and it looks mighty tasty.

The restaurant opened in 1994, and some of the original employees still work there … more

City Cafe undergoes remodeling

City Cafe on West Lovers has temporarily closed until Aug. 9 for a “face lift” that will ultimately celebrate the restaurant’s 25-year, silver anniversary, according to a DMN update.

Since 1985, this neighborhood bistro has been recognized as one of the most prestigious dining spots in Dallas. It will be … more

Learn to preserve your neighborhood trees

The city has launched the new program Citizen Forester, a course that teaches people how to protect the trees in their neighborhoods. The program will educate people on the process for planting trees in the city and caring for them. You also can get some good information on tree identification … more
